2008 European Tour - Table of Results

Table of Results

The table below shows the 2008 schedule. There are 50 official money events, of which the first six events take place in late 2007. The season runs for 52 weeks, with a three week break over Christmas and the New Year, and one week when the only event is an unofficial money team tournament. There are two weeks when two official money events are played.

The numbers in brackets after the winners' names show the number of career wins they had on the European Tour up to and including that event. This is only shown for members of the European Tour. To give such a number for non-members would misrepresent the amount of time some international golfers spend on the European Tour; as the Tour co-sanctions the major championships and World Golf Championships events, some top players accumulate a significant number of wins in European Tour sanctioned events without really playing on it. For example, Tiger Woods has won more than thirty events sanctioned by the European Tour, but has never played a sufficient number of European Tour-sanctioned events to qualify for membership.

Dates Tournament Host country Winner OWGR
points
Notes
8-11 Nov HSBC Champions China Phil Mickelson (n/a) 52 Co-sanctioned by three other tours
15-18 Nov UBS Hong Kong Open Hong Kong, China Miguel Ángel Jiménez (14) 36 Co-sanctioned with the Asian Tour
22-25 Nov MasterCard Masters Australia Aaron Baddeley (n/a) 24 Co-sanctioned with the PGA Tour of Australasia
29 Nov-2 Dec Michael Hill New Zealand Open New Zealand Richard Finch (1) 20 Co-sanctioned with the PGA Tour of Australasia
6-9 Dec Alfred Dunhill Championship South Africa John Bickerton (3) 22 Co-sanctioned with the Sunshine Tour
13-16 Dec South African Airways Open South Africa James Kingston (1) 32 Co-sanctioned with the Sunshine Tour
10-13 Jan Joburg Open South Africa Richard Sterne (3) 20 Co-sanctioned with the Sunshine Tour
17-20 Jan Abu Dhabi Golf Championship United Arab Emirates Martin Kaymer (1) 44
24-27 Jan The Commercialbank Qatar Masters Qatar Adam Scott (6) 46
31 Jan-3 Feb Dubai Desert Classic United Arab Emirates Tiger Woods (n/a) 50
7-10 Feb Emaar-MGF Indian Masters India Shiv Chowrasia (1) 26 Co-sanctioned with the Asian Tour; new tournament
14-17 Feb Astro Indonesia Open Indonesia Felipe Aguilar (1) 20 Co-sanctioned with the Asian Tour
20-24 Feb WGC-Accenture Match Play Championship United States Tiger Woods (n/a) 76 World Golf Championships
28 Feb-2 Mar Johnnie Walker Classic India Mark Brown (1) 38 Co-sanctioned with the Asian Tour and PGA Tour of Australasia
6-9 Mar Maybank Malaysian Open Malaysia Arjun Atwal (3) 24 Co-sanctioned with the Asian Tour
13-16 Mar Ballantine's Championship South Korea Graeme McDowell (3) 28 Co-sanctioned with the Asian Tour; new tournament
20-23 Mar WGC-CA Championship United States Geoff Ogilvy (n/a) 76 World Golf Championships
20-23 Mar Madeira Island Open Portugal Alastair Forsyth (2) 24 First event in Europe; alternate to the WGC event
27-30 Mar MAPFRE Open de Andalucia Spain Thomas Levet (4) 24
3-6 Apr Estoril Open de Portugal Portugal Grégory Bourdy (2) 24
10-13 Apr The Masters United States Trevor Immelman (4) 100 Major championship
17-20 Apr Volvo China Open China Damien McGrane (1) 20 Co-sanctioned with the Asian Tour
24-27 Apr BMW Asian Open China Darren Clarke (11) 32 Co-sanctioned with the Asian Tour
1-4 May Open de España Spain Peter Lawrie (1) 24
8-11 May Italian Open Italy Hennie Otto (1) 24
15-18 May Irish Open Republic of Ireland Richard Finch (2) 28
22-25 May BMW PGA Championship England Miguel Ángel Jiménez (15) 64 The European Tour's "Home Tournament"
29 May - 1 Jun Celtic Manor Wales Open Wales Scott Strange (1) 36
5-8 Jun Bank Austria GolfOpen Austria Jeev Milkha Singh (3) 24
12-15 Jun U.S. Open United States Tiger Woods (n/a) 100 Major championship
12-15 Jun Saint-Omer Open France David Dixon (1) 18 Alternate to the U.S. Open; also a Challenge Tour event
19-22 Jun BMW International Open Germany Martin Kaymer (2) 30
26-29 Jun Open de France France Pablo Larrazábal (1) 38
3-6 Jul European Open England Ross Fisher (2) 40
10-13 Jul Barclays Scottish Open Scotland Graeme McDowell (4) 50 The richest sole-sanctioned event in 2007
17-20 Jul The Open Championship United Kingdom Pádraig Harrington (13) 100 Major championship
24-27 Jul Inteco Russian Open Russia Mikael Lundberg (2) 24
31 Jul - 3 Aug WGC-Bridgestone Invitational United States Vijay Singh (13) 74 World Golf Championships
7-10 Aug PGA Championship United States Pádraig Harrington (14) 100 Major championship
14-17 Aug SAS Masters Sweden Peter Hanson (2) 24
21-24 Aug KLM Open Netherlands Darren Clarke (12) 30
28-31 Aug Johnnie Walker Championship at Gleneagles Scotland Grégory Havret (3) 32
4-7 Sep Omega European Masters Switzerland Jean-François Lucquin (1) 24
11-14 Sep Mercedes-Benz Championship Germany Robert Karlsson (8) 34
19-21 Sep Ryder Cup United States United States n/a Team event - Europe v. United States
25-28 Sep Quinn Insurance British Masters England Gonzalo Fernández-Castaño (4) 30
2-5 Oct Alfred Dunhill Links Championship Scotland Robert Karlsson (9) 50 Celebrity pro-am
9-12 Oct Madrid Masters Spain Charl Schwartzel (3) 24 New tournament
16-19 Oct Portugal Masters Portugal Álvaro Quirós (2) 38
23-26 Oct Castelló Masters Costa Azahar Spain Sergio García (7) 38 New tournament
30 Oct - 2 Nov Volvo Masters Spain Søren Kjeldsen (2) 50
